On the Sunday Morning show today there was an interesting segment about a Kansas city minister who has started the world wide program of,
"A Complaint Free World."
On of the basics of the program is a purple bracelet, ala lance Armstrong. You put it on one wrist, and when you hear yourself complaining you move it to your other wrist. 21 days, complaint free is the goal. Millions of these have been sent worldwide.
April of 09, there will be a complaint free Carnival cruise, with seminars from the charismatic minister, Will Bowen.
